Visual Identity
An essential part of the Andover brand is its visual identity—elements that include Phillips Academy’s official logos, wordmarks, colors, and fonts. Many of these elements honor the school’s history and remain integral to its narrative today. The following resources are meant to guide consistent expression of the Academy’s visual style.
Please help to uphold these standards by ensuring that Phillips Academy brandmark, wordmark, seal, other brand graphics (or any of their elements) are not reconstructed or altered in anyway.
Custom logos are rarely created. Such requests must first be approved by the senior administration. If creation of a custom logo is approved, the Office of Communication will provide strategic oversight, design, and final approval.

Identity
Official digital art files must be used when applying Phillips Academy brand marks to communications or materials. The “A”, the seal and wordmark, and any other brand element that represents Phillips Academy must not be recreated, distorted, or changed in any way; this includes altering the font, shape, colors, opacity, or adding a drop shadow.

Phillips Academy Seal Lockup
The Academy’s historic seal combined with the Phillips Academy Andover wordmark is reserved for formal uses only, such as diplomas and head of school communications. Those who would like to use the Phillips Academy seal and wordmark need approval from the Communications Office. Please email [email protected].
This is a vertical configuration only. The seal should not be used in a horizontal format or without the wordmark. The minimum width of PA seal and wordmark is 1 inch in print and 132 pixels in digital uses.
Use of the Phillips Academy seal on its own is prohibited as a graphic element without permission from the Communications Office.

Abbot Seal Lockup
The Abbot Academy seal is the primary brand mark for identifying Abbot Academy, one of the first educational institutions for girls that was open from 1829 to 1973.
If you would like to use the Abbot Academy seal, please email [email protected] for more details and information on how to download.
Usage requirements: The Abbot Academy seal should be used as a vertical configuration only. The seal should not be used in a horizontal format or used to create any new logo. The minimum width of PA seal is 1 inch in print and 132 pixels in digital uses.

Secondary Brand Marks
The official “Andover A” was adopted as the “A for all” in 2024. While various versions of the A have existed for centuries, this official mark honors the 50th anniversary since the merger of Abbot Academy and Phillips Academy.
